Appearance #49! Letter 44 #5 by Alberto Alburquerque!

March 19, 2014

When I read announcements for new titles, really love the preview pages and get psyched for the book... I do my DMI thing early and sometimes get really lucky. This is one of those instances.


First off, where did Charles Soule come from? He's become one of my favorite writers at the moment. And he's writing tons of books at the moment, most of which I'm reading. So yeah I was on board for his creative owned series at Oni Press.

Alberto seemed interested in my campaign, asking questions and the sort, and said "I'll see what I can do to include you in one of my pages".

A few months later I'm told to keep an eye out for issue #5 of Letter 44! Great series! Cool appearance!

49... 50!

March 4, 2014

A DMI milestone is just around the corner...

I have confirmation of my next two appearances, putting me on track to reach FIFTY comic book appearances.

COMICS! WHAT A HOBBY!

In a few weeks I look forward picking up Letter 44 #5 (Oni Press), written by Charles Soule (I think I'm reading all his books at the moment) with Alberto Alburquerque on art!

And then next month, continuing the story of the great rebooted game series of the same name... Tomb Raider #3 (Dark Horse) written by Gail Simone and pencils by Nicolás Daniel Selma!
